Agri-Innovation Program is a No Interest Business Loan up to $5M

Businesses in the agriculture sector can receive an additional source of cash through the Agri-Innovation Program. Offered through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ada, the Agri-Innovation Program provides agricultural businesses across Canada with 0% interest repayable funding towards a variety of expenditures that will improve the company’s productivity or promote innovation. Develop New Agri-Tech with the Canadian Agricultural Adaptation Program

As part of Canada’s Economic Action Plan, the $163-million Canadian Agricultural Adaptation Program (CAAP) was designed to help Canadian agricultural firms adapt to new and emerging issues in the industry by developing and conducting pilot test on new technologies and innovations related to the agricultural sector. Ontario Market Investment Fund (OMIF)

The Ontario Market Investment Fund is a $12-million; four-year fund targeted to promote awareness of Ontario-produced foods and encourages the public in Ontario to buy locally. The following are project ideas that qualify for this program: market research, communication and/or marketing projects encouraging local buying of produce.
